29% Tip on $152 Bill
29% tip on a $152 bill: $44.08. Free tip calculator with split bill option.
$44.08
Tip = $152 x (29/100) = $44.08. Total with tip = $196.08.
How This Was Calculated
Tip Amount: Tip = Bill ร (Tip% / 100)
Total: Total = Bill + Tip
Per Person: Per Person = Total / Number of People
